When it comes to developing an iPad app, businesses have to decide whether to outsource the development to a third-party company or keep the process in-house. Both options have their own set of pros and cons, as well as cost implications that need to be carefully considered. In this article, we will explore the advantages and disadvantages of outsourcing versus in-house iPad app development, and analyze the potential costs associated with each approach.
Outsourcing iPad App Development
Outsourcing iPad app development involves hiring a third-party company or team to design, develop, and deploy the app on behalf of the business. Some of the key benefits of outsourcing app development include:
Pros:
- Cost Savings: Outsourcing app development can often be more cost-effective than hiring an in-house team. This is because outsourcing companies are typically based in countries with lower labor costs, which can result in significant savings for the business.
- Expertise: Outsourcing companies specialize in app development and have a team of experienced professionals who are well-versed in the latest technologies and trends. This can result in a higher quality app that meets the business’s requirements.
- Faster Time to Market: Outsourcing app development can help businesses speed up the development process and get their app to market faster. This is because outsourcing companies have dedicated teams working on the project, which can lead to quicker turnaround times.
- Scalability: Outsourcing companies can easily scale up or down the team working on the app based on the project requirements. This flexibility can be beneficial for businesses with fluctuating workloads.
Cons:
- Communication Challenges: One of the main drawbacks of outsourcing app development is the potential for communication challenges. Working with a remote team can sometimes lead to misunderstandings or delays in the development process.
- Quality Control: Businesses may have less control over the development process when outsourcing, which can result in issues with quality control. It is important to carefully vet and communicate with the outsourcing company to ensure the app meets expectations.
In-House iPad App Development
In-house app development involves hiring a team of developers and designers to work within the company to create the app. Some of the advantages and disadvantages of in-house development include:
Pros:
- Control: In-house development gives businesses more control over the development process and allows for greater collaboration between team members. This can result in a more customized app that meets the business’s specific needs.
- Security: Keeping app development in-house can help businesses maintain control over sensitive data and intellectual property. This can be particularly important for companies in industries with strict security requirements.
- Familiarity: In-house teams are more familiar with the business’s goals, processes, and culture, which can result in a more cohesive app that aligns with the company’s overall strategy.
Cons:
- Cost: In-house app development can be more expensive than outsourcing, as it requires hiring and maintaining a team of developers, designers, and project managers. This can result in higher upfront costs and ongoing expenses.
- Skill Gaps: In-house teams may not always have the same level of expertise as outsourcing companies, especially when it comes to specialized technologies or niche markets. This can result in longer development times or lower quality apps.
Cost Implications
When considering the cost implications of outsourcing versus in-house iPad app development, businesses need to take into account factors such as:
- Upfront Costs: Outsourcing app development typically requires a lower upfront investment compared to in-house development, which may involve hiring and training new employees.
- Ongoing Expenses: In-house development can result in higher ongoing expenses, such as salaries, benefits, and overhead costs, whereas outsourcing may offer more predictable pricing structures.
- Quality and Time: The cost of developing an app can also be influenced by the quality and time it takes to complete the project. While outsourcing may offer cost savings, businesses should also consider the potential impact on app quality and time to market.
In conclusion, the decision to outsource or keep iPad app development in-house will depend on the specific needs and resources of the business. Both options have their own set of pros and cons, as well as cost implications that need to be carefully considered. By weighing the advantages and disadvantages of each approach, businesses can make an informed decision that aligns with their goals and budget. Contact us today for affordable app development costs tailored to your needs! Let’s bring your app idea to life without breaking the budget.
FAQs:
1. What are the advantages of outsourcing iPad app development?
Outsourcing iPad app development can result in cost savings, access to expertise, faster time to market, and scalability for businesses.
2. What are the potential drawbacks of outsourcing app development?
Communication challenges and issues with quality control are some of the cons associated with outsourcing app development.
3. What are the benefits of in-house iPad app development?
In-house app development allows for greater control over the development process, better communication, and potentially higher quality apps.
4. What are the cost implications of in-house app development?
In-house app development may have higher initial costs due to hiring a team of developers, but can result in long-term cost savings compared to outsourcing.